Teaching Voice: Martinique has been a professional singer and piano player for more than 20 years. She has a three octave vocal range and has, during her professional career, sang in all genres, in live performances as well as studio work. She has had a successful career with singing, songwriting and piano playing and has received much airplay in various parts of the world with her CD “Tangled Web of Cool”. Martinique Walker studied voice for 7 years with various teachers, the most notable being Maestro David Kyle who taught on Broadway in New York for 35 years. He also trained opera singers, and rock singers such as Anne Wilson from “Heart” and QueensRyke. He gave speech lessons to such celebrities as Johnny Carson and James Garner. Martinique has combined David Kyle’s excellent techniques with her own experiences and techniques to come up with a strong and full proof method for discovering the voice that lies within. Her techniques involve simple but effective breathing exercises to learn the vocal breath, and strengthen the body, resonating exercises, to produce great sounds and vocal exercises to increase the range. Learning to sing involves the whole body and Martinique combines the teaching of these techniques with the proper use of the body. It comes together to produce a relaxed, not tense, singer. This frees the voice and allows the singer to express his/her individuality. The techniques work for all types of singing. |
